> > > know if the hardy hibs are hardy up in zone 6 where Jesse is?
> The big dinner-plate types like Lord Baltimore, Fantasia, Galaxy, Kopper
> King, Southern Belle, and Turn of the Century - Hibiscus moscheutos ? These
> are hardy here in Zone 5.

> > There have been hardy hibiscus growing here in Lewiston for years, even
> when
> > we were still zone 5 on the charts. Sometimes they die to the ground, but
> > roots don't die & they quickly grow back to size.
